Chemours is seeking a Chemical Engineer Co-op to join our La Porte Technology team ! This position will report directly to the La Porte Manufacturing Technology Manage r .


As a Chemical Engineer Co-op, you will work closely with the La Porte Technology team gaining valuable experience through hands-on projects in a chemical plant . You will have exposure to real-time engineering work alongside other engineers to apply what you’ve learned in the classroom.


Effective engineering co-ops will have the ability to communicate with impact , have strong self-awareness, and will be naturally inquisitive.


Location: La Porte, TX


Hours: Regular full-time schedule of 40 hours per week


Preferred First Term: January - May 2025


Candidates must be able to commit to at least a total of six (6) months as a co-op. Two (2) or more terms may be required.


The responsibilities of the position include, but are not limited to, the following:


  • Work ing with experienced engineering professionals on improvement and expansion projects

  • Assisting operations and maintenance with troubleshooting, root cause analysis, and problem solving

  • Participating in process safety management activities and reviews

  • Contributing to team meetings and conference calls

The following is required for this role :
  • Enrollment at an accredited college or university as a Sophomore or above at time of assignment

  • Pursuing an undergraduate degree in Chemical Engineering or similar fields

  • Familiarity with Microsoft Word, Excel, and Power Point

The following is preferred for this role :
  • Participation in relevant activities , organizations, and projects beyond the classroom

  • 3 .0 GPA or above
